Your ATAR may be recalculated: if NESA provides amended HSC results to UAC. if you repeat courses you have already completed. if you complete additional courses. Institutions use your latest ATAR for selection purposes, which could be higher or lower than – or the same as – a previous ATAR.

It means they are 20% from the top of their age group. flip out castle hillsWebATAR stands for Australian Tertiary Admissions Rank. It is a number between zero and 99.95 that tells your position in your year group.
